Guida alle Macro di World of Warcraft: Migliora il tuo Gameplay con Macro Efficaci

Padroneggiare le Macro: Una Guida Completa

Le macro sono strumenti potenti in World of Warcraft che ti permettono di semplificare il tuo gameplay e di scatenare azioni complesse con la semplice pressione di un tasto. Questa guida approfondirà le complessità della creazione di macro, consentendoti di sfruttarne appieno il potenziale.

Cos’è una Macro?

Immagina una macro come un pulsante personalizzabile che puoi trascinare sulle tue barre delle azioni dal menu /macro o /m. Consideralo come uno strumento multiuso programmabile, in grado di adattare la sua funzione in base a condizioni specifiche. Sia che tu voglia eseguire una serie di incantesimi contemporaneamente o creare azioni dinamiche che rispondono a diverse situazioni, le macro offrono la flessibilità necessaria per migliorare il tuo gameplay.

Il Potere delle Condizioni

Uno degli aspetti più preziosi delle macro risiede nella loro capacità di eseguire azioni diverse in base a condizioni predefinite. Esploriamo i tipi di condizioni che puoi utilizzare:

Caratteristiche del Bersaglio:

  • Aiuto/Danno: Determina se il tuo bersaglio è amichevole o ostile.
  • Morto/Non Morto: Controlla se il tuo bersaglio è vivo o morto.
  • Esiste/Non Esiste: Verifica se un bersaglio esiste. Nota che le condizioni di danno/aiuto includono automaticamente un controllo "Esiste".

Stato del Tuo Personaggio:

  • Tipo di Gruppo: Adatta le azioni in base al fatto che tu sia in un gruppo, in un raid o da solo.
  • Lancio/Non Lancio, Canalizzazione/Non Canalizzazione: Rispondi al tuo stato di lancio corrente.
  • Combattimento/Non Combattimento: Attiva azioni in base al tuo stato di combattimento.
  • Volo/Nuoto: Adattati al tuo ambiente.
  • Equipaggiato, Famiglio/Nessun Famiglio, Famiglio:<tipo di famiglia>: Crea azioni specifiche per il tuo equipaggiamento o famiglio.
  • Diverse Forme, Diverse Specializzazioni, Talento/Incantesimo Conosciuto: Personalizza le azioni in base alla tua specializzazione, forma o abilità disponibili.

Bersagli/Luoghi Specifici:

  • @<nome unità>: Bersaglia un’unità specifica per nome.
  • @giocatore: Bersaglia te stesso.
  • @focus: Bersaglia il tuo bersaglio focalizzato.
  • @bersaglio: Bersaglia il tuo bersaglio corrente.
  • @bersagliodelbersaglio: Bersaglia il bersaglio del tuo bersaglio.
  • @mouseover: Bersaglia l’unità su cui si trova il tuo mouse.
  • @gruppo/raid/arena#: Bersaglia membri specifici del gruppo, del raid o dell’arena.
  • @cursore: Bersaglia la posizione del tuo cursore (per gli incantesimi basati sul reticolo).

Modificatori e Altro:

  • Modificatori: Attiva azioni diverse quando tieni premuti Ctrl, Shift o Alt. Nota che gli slot macro modificati non possono avere associazioni di tasti in conflitto.
  • Slot Oggetti: Attiva slot oggetti specifici, come monili o armi.

Inversione e Lista Completa:

La maggior parte delle condizioni può essere invertita aggiungendo "no" davanti a esse (ad esempio, "combattimento" diventa "nocombattimento"). Per un elenco completo delle condizioni macro, consulta la pagina Condizioni Macro su Wowpedia.

Limitazioni delle Macro: Cosa Non Puoi Fare

Sebbene incredibilmente versatili, le macro hanno dei limiti. Non possono:

  • Controllare i tempi di recupero degli incantesimi o degli oggetti.
  • Determinare se un bersaglio sta lanciando.
  • Accedere alla tua salute o alla percentuale di salute del tuo bersaglio.
  • Rilevare buff o debuff attivi.
  • Prendere decisioni basate su eventi dinamici.

In sostanza, le macro non possono giocare per te o reagire a situazioni imprevedibili con poche eccezioni. Sfruttare queste eccezioni è generalmente disapprovato e può portare a penalità.

Sequenze di Lancio e Casualizzazione

Le macro possono eseguire incantesimi in sequenza o casualmente utilizzando rispettivamente i comandi /castsequence e /castrandom.

Sequenza di Lancio:

/castsequence lancia gli incantesimi nell’ordine in cui li elenchi, separati da virgole. Puoi aggiungere una condizione reset=<secondi>/bersaglio/combattimento per definire quando la sequenza si ripristina. Per esempio:

/castsequence reset=bersaglio Luce Lunare, Fuoco Solare, Bagliore Stellare

Questa macro lancia Luce Lunare, poi Fuoco Solare, poi Bagliore Stellare, ripristinando a Luce Lunare quando cambi bersaglio.

Lancio Casuale:

/castrandom lancia casualmente uno degli incantesimi o utilizza uno degli oggetti elencati, separati da virgole. Questo è utile per cavalcature, giocattoli o altre abilità non di combattimento.

Limitazioni:

Tieni presente che sia /castsequence che /castrandom sono limitati nella loro reattività. Generalmente non sono ideali per situazioni di combattimento in cui l’adattabilità è fondamentale.

Azioni Multiple e Comandi Utili

Le macro possono eseguire più azioni contemporaneamente, purché solo un incantesimo sia in cooldown globale (GCD). Questo è particolarmente utile per combinare abilità fuori GCD, monili o oggetti con i tuoi incantesimi.

Ecco alcuni comandi macro comunemente usati:

  • /cast e /use: Lancia incantesimi o usa oggetti.
  • /stopcasting: Annulla il tuo lancio corrente.
  • /cancelaura <nome buff>: Tenta di annullare un buff specifico.
  • /equip <nome oggetto>: Equipaggia un oggetto (solo armi in combattimento).
  • /equipset <nome set>: Equipaggia un set di oggetti salvato.
  • /petattack, /petpassive/defensive/assist: Controlla il comportamento del tuo famiglio.
  • Emoticon: Aggiungi sapore alle tue azioni (ad esempio, /ruggito).
  • /stopmacro: Impedisci l’esecuzione di qualsiasi comando al di sotto di esso.
  • /run e /script: Esegui script Lua (utilizzo avanzato).

Per un elenco completo dei comandi macro, visita la pagina Comandi Macro su Wowpedia.

Struttura delle Macro e Best Practice

Comprendere la struttura di una macro è fondamentale per creare comandi efficaci e privi di errori.

  • Parentesi: Le condizioni sono racchiuse tra parentesi [ ], separate da virgole. Più condizioni all’interno di una parentesi fungono da istruzione "AND", il che significa che tutte le condizioni devono essere soddisfatte.
  • Punto e virgola: Separa diversi lanci di incantesimi o azioni all’interno di una macro.
  • #showtooltip: Imposta l’icona e la descrizione comandi della macro in modo che corrispondano all’incantesimo attivo in base alle condizioni o a un incantesimo specificato.
  • #show: Imposta solo l’icona della macro, senza la descrizione comandi.
  • Ordine delle Operazioni: Le macro eseguono i comandi dall’alto verso il basso.

Suggerimenti:

  • Utilizza i nomi completi degli incantesimi/oggetti o i loro ID per chiarezza.
  • Considera l’utilizzo degli slot dell’equipaggiamento invece dei nomi degli oggetti per evitare di aggiornare le macro quando l’equipaggiamento cambia.
  • Tieni presente il limite di 255 caratteri.

Esempi di Macro

Mettiamo tutto insieme con alcuni esempi pratici:

1. Controincantesimo al Passaggio del Mouse:

#showtooltip
/cast [@mouseover,harm,nodead][] Controincantesimo

Questa macro lancia Controincantesimo sul tuo bersaglio al passaggio del mouse se è ostile e vivo; altrimenti, lo lancia sul tuo bersaglio corrente.

2. Guarigione Condizionata:

#showtooltip
/cast [@mouseover,help,nodead][] Parola di Potere: Scudo

Questa macro lancia Parola di Potere: Scudo sul tuo bersaglio al passaggio del mouse se è amichevole e vivo; altrimenti, lo lancia sul tuo bersaglio corrente.

3. Incantesimo Multi-Bersaglio:

#showtooltip
/cast [@mouseover,harm,nodead] Folgore di Fiamme; [@mouseover,help,nodead][] Marea Benefica

Questa macro dà la priorità al lancio di Folgore di Fiamme su un bersaglio ostile al passaggio del mouse. Se il bersaglio al passaggio del mouse è amichevole o non ce n’è uno, lancia Marea Benefica sul tuo bersaglio corrente.

4. Prevenzione della Canalizzazione:

#showtooltip Flagello Mentale
/cast [nochanneling] Flagello Mentale

Questa macro lancia Flagello Mentale solo se non stai attualmente canalizzando un altro incantesimo.

5. Macro Cooldown Burst:

#showtooltip
/cast [spec:1] Allineamento Celeste; [spec:2/3] Berserk; [spec:4] Incarnazione: Albero della Vita
/cast Furia Berserker
/use 14
/use [group:raid] Pozione Elementale del Potere Definitivo
/use Bolla Prismatica

Questa macro utilizza il tuo cooldown specifico per la specializzazione, l’abilità razziale, il monile, una pozione specifica per il raid e un divertente giocattolo.

6. Incantesimo ad Area d’Effetto Modificato:

#showtooltip
/cast [mod:shift,@cursor][mod:alt,@giocatore][] Morte e Decomposizione

Questa macro lancia Morte e Decomposizione nella posizione del tuo cursore mentre tieni premuto Shift, ai tuoi piedi mentre tieni premuto Alt o nella posizione del tuo bersaglio corrente altrimenti.

7. Devizione Multi-Bersaglio:

#showtooltip
/cast [@mouseover,help,nodead][@focus,help,nodead][@pet,exists,nodead][] Devizione

Questa macro dà la priorità al lancio di Devizione su un bersaglio amichevole al passaggio del mouse, quindi sul tuo bersaglio focalizzato, quindi sul tuo famiglio e infine sul tuo bersaglio corrente.

8. Messaggio Chat con Incantesimo:

#showtooltip
/cast Crea Pozzo dell'Anima
/s Biscotti caldi dello stregone!

Questa macro lancia Crea Pozzo dell’Anima e invia un messaggio amichevole alla chat.

9. Impostazione del Bersaglio Focalizzato:

/focus [@mouseover,exists]

Questa macro imposta il tuo bersaglio focalizzato sul tuo bersaglio al passaggio del mouse.

10. Pulsante Azione Extra:

#showtooltip
/click ExtraActionButton1

Questa macro attiva il pulsante Azione Extra, che a volte viene utilizzato per incontri o missioni specifici.

11. Macro Cavalcatura Tutto in Uno:

#showtooltip
/cast [swimming] Cavalcatura Acquatica Desiderata; [advflyable] Cavalcatura Volo Draconico Desiderata; [flyable] Cavalcatura Volante Desiderata; Cavalcatura Terrestre Desiderata

Questa macro ti fa salire sulla cavalcatura appropriata in base al tuo ambiente corrente e alle capacità della cavalcatura.

Conclusione

Questa guida ti ha fornito le conoscenze necessarie per creare macro potenti ed efficienti, migliorando il tuo gameplay in World of Warcraft. Sperimenta con diverse condizioni, comandi e combinazioni per adattare le macro al tuo stile di gioco individuale e massimizzare la tua efficacia in Azeroth.

Analytics